package entrypoint
import (
"context"
"fmt"
"github.com/datawire/ambassador/v2/pkg/kates"
"github.com/datawire/dlib/dlog"
)
// thingToWatch is... uh... a thing we're gonna watch. Specifically, it's a
// K8s type name and an optional field selector.
type thingToWatch struct {
typename string
fieldselector string
}
type thingToMaybeWatch struct {
typename string
fieldselector string
ignoreIf bool
}
// GetQueries takes a set of interesting types, and returns a set of kates.Query to watch
// for them.
func GetQueries(ctx context.Context, interestingTypes map[string]thingToWatch) []kates.Query {
ns := kates.NamespaceAll
if IsAmbassadorSingleNamespace() {
ns = GetAmbassadorNamespace()
}
fs := GetAmbassadorFieldSelector()
ls := GetAmbassadorLabelSelector()
var queries []kates.Query
for snapshotname, queryinfo := range interestingTypes {
query := kates.Query{
Namespace: ns,
Name: snapshotname,
Kind: queryinfo.typename,
FieldSelector: queryinfo.fieldselector,
LabelSelector: ls,
}
if query.FieldSelector == "" {
query.FieldSelector = fs
}
queries = append(queries, query)
dlog.Debugf(ctx, "WATCHER: watching %#v", query)
}
return queries
}
// GetInterestingTypes takes a list of available server types, and returns the types we think
// are interesting to watch.
func GetInterestingTypes(ctx context.Context, serverTypeList []kates.APIResource) map[string]thingToWatch {
fs := GetAmbassadorFieldSelector()
endpointFs := "metadata.namespace!=kube-system"
if fs != "" {
endpointFs += fmt.Sprintf(",%s", fs)
}
// We set interestingTypes to the list of types that we'd like to watch (if that type exits
// in this cluster).
//
// - The key in the map is the how we'll label them in the snapshot we pass to the rest of
// Ambassador.
// - The map values are a list, of potential things to watch (based on which of them exist),
// ordered from lowest-priority to highest-priority.
// - The typename in the map values should be the qualified "${name}.${version}.${group}",
// where "${name} is lowercase+plural.
// - If the map value doesn't set a field selector, then `fs` (above) will be used.
//
// Most of the interestingTypes are static, but it's completely OK to add types based
// on runtime considerations, as we do for IngressClass and the KNative stuff.
interestingTypes := map[string][]thingToMaybeWatch{
// Native Kubernetes types
//
// Note that we pull `secrets.v1.` in to "K8sSecrets". ReconcileSecrets will pull
// over the ones we need into "Secrets" and "Endpoints" respectively.
"Services": {{typename: "services.v1."}}, // New in Kubernetes 0.16.0 (2015-04-28) (v1beta{1..3} before that)
"Endpoints": {{typename: "endpoints.v1.", fieldselector: endpointFs}}, // New in Kubernetes 0.16.0 (2015-04-28) (v1beta{1..3} before that)
"K8sSecrets": {{typename: "secrets.v1."}}, // New in Kubernetes 0.16.0 (2015-04-28) (v1beta{1..3} before that)
"Ingresses": {
{typename: "ingresses.v1beta1.extensions"}, // New in Kubernetes 1.2.0 (2016-03-16), gone in Kubernetes 1.22.0 (2021-08-04)
{typename: "ingresses.v1beta1.networking.k8s.io"}, // New in Kubernetes 1.14.0 (2019-03-25), gone in Kubernetes 1.22.0 (2021-08-04)
{typename: "ingresses.v1.networking.k8s.io"}, // New in Kubernetes 1.19.0 (2020-08-26)
},
"IngressClasses": {
{typename: "ingressclasses.v1beta1.networking.k8s.io", ignoreIf: IsAmbassadorSingleNamespace()}, // New in Kubernetes 1.18.0 (2020-03-25), gone in Kubernetes 1.22.0 (2021-08-04)
{typename: "ingressclasses.v1.networking.k8s.io", ignoreIf: IsAmbassadorSingleNamespace()}, // New in Kubernetes 1.19.0 (2020-08-26)
},
// Gateway API (of which Emissary is one of the implementations)
"GatewayClasses": {
{typename: "gatewayclasses.v1alpha1.networking.x-k8s.io"}, // New in gateway-api 0.1.0 (2020-11-18)
//{typename: "gatewayclasses.v1alpha2.gateway.networking.k8s.io"}, // Not yet released
},
"Gateways": {
{typename: "gateways.v1alpha1.networking.x-k8s.io"}, // New in gateway-api 0.1.0 (2020-11-18)
//{typename: "gateways.v1alpha2.gateway.networking.k8s.io"}, // Not yet released
},
"HTTPRoutes": {
{typename: "httproutes.v1alpha1.networking.x-k8s.io"}, // New in gateway-api 0.1.0 (2020-11-18)
//{typename: "httproutes.v1alpha2.gateway.networking.k8s.io"}, // Not yet released
},
// Knative types
//
// Note: These keynames have a "KNative" prefix, to avoid clashing with the standard
// "networking.k8s.io" and "extensions" types.
"KNativeClusterIngresses": {{typename: "clusteringresses.v1alpha1.networking.internal.knative.dev", ignoreIf: !IsKnativeEnabled()}}, // New in Knative Serving 0.3.0 (2019-01-09)
"KNativeIngresses": {{typename: "ingresses.v1alpha1.networking.internal.knative.dev", ignoreIf: !IsKnativeEnabled()}}, // New in Knative Serving 0.7.0 (2019-06-25)
// Native Emissary types
"AuthServices": {{typename: "authservices.v3alpha1.getambassador.io"}},
"ConsulResolvers": {{typename: "consulresolvers.v3alpha1.getambassador.io"}},
"DevPortals": {{typename: "devportals.v3alpha1.getambassador.io"}},
"Hosts": {{typename: "hosts.v3alpha1.getambassador.io"}},
"KubernetesEndpointResolvers": {{typename: "kubernetesendpointresolvers.v3alpha1.getambassador.io"}},
"KubernetesServiceResolvers": {{typename: "kubernetesserviceresolvers.v3alpha1.getambassador.io"}},
"Listeners": {{typename: "listeners.v3alpha1.getambassador.io"}},
"LogServices": {{typename: "logservices.v3alpha1.getambassador.io"}},
"Mappings": {{typename: "mappings.v3alpha1.getambassador.io"}},
"Modules": {{typename: "modules.v3alpha1.getambassador.io"}},
"RateLimitServices": {{typename: "ratelimitservices.v3alpha1.getambassador.io"}},
"TCPMappings": {{typename: "tcpmappings.v3alpha1.getambassador.io"}},
"TLSContexts": {{typename: "tlscontexts.v3alpha1.getambassador.io"}},
"TracingServices": {{typename: "tracingservices.v3alpha1.getambassador.io"}},
}
var serverTypes map[string]kates.APIResource
if serverTypeList != nil {
serverTypes = make(map[string]kates.APIResource, len(serverTypeList))
for _, typeinfo := range serverTypeList {
serverTypes[typeinfo.Name+"."+typeinfo.Version+"."+typeinfo.Group] = typeinfo
}
}
ret := make(map[string]thingToWatch)
for k, queryinfos := range interestingTypes {
var last thingToWatch
for _, queryinfo := range queryinfos {
if queryinfo.ignoreIf {
continue
}
last = thingToWatch{queryinfo.typename, queryinfo.fieldselector}
if _, haveType := serverTypes[queryinfo.typename]; haveType || serverTypes == nil {
ret[k] = last
}
}
if _, found := ret[k]; !found && last != (thingToWatch{}) {
dlog.Warnf(ctx, "Warning, unable to watch %s, unknown kind.", last.typename)
}
}
return ret
}
